16 / 24 page ![]() AD8335 Rev. 0 | Page 16 of 24 THEORY OF OPERATION Figure 54 is a simplified block diagram of a single channel. Each channel consists of a low noise preamplifier (PrA) followed by a VGA with a user-selectable gain of 20 dB or 28 dB. Channels are enabled in pairs, Channels 1 and 2 and Channels 3 and 4. The preamps are enabled by grounding Pins SPxx and powered down by connecting them to the positive supply. The ENxx pins are connected to the positive supply to enable the VGAs and the overall channel. HILO configures VGA for a fixed gain of 20 dB or 28 dB, with 0 V or 5 V applied to the HLxx pins, respectively. Channels 1 and 2 share Pin HL12, and Channels 3 and 4 share Pin HL34. The HLxx pins are typically hardwired to adjust the VGA gain according to an ADC resolution of 12 bits for LO gain and 10 bits for HI gain. The signal path is fully differential throughout to maximize signal swing and reduce even-order distortion; however, the preamplifiers are designed to be driven from a single-ended signal source. Gain values are referenced from the single-ended PrA input to the differential output of either the PrA or the VGA. Again referring to Figure 54, the system gain is distributed as listed in Table 4. Channel Gain Distribution Section LO Nominal Gain (dB) HI Nominal Gain (dB) PrA 18.06 18.06 Attenuator 0 to −48.16 0 to −48.16 Output Amp 20 27.96 Aggregate −10.1 to +38.6 −2.14 to +46.02 In the remainder of this document, the gain values are rounded to −10 dB to +38 dB for LO gain mode and to −2 dB to +46 dB for HI gain mode. If desired, Equation 1 can be used to calculate the gain at value of VGAIN: ICPT V V dB dB Gain GN + = 20 ) ( (1) where ICPT = −16.1 dB for LO gain mode with the preamp input matched to 50 Ω (RFB = 250 Ω) and −10.1 dB for the unmatched input case. For HI gain mode, these numbers are −8.1 dB and −2.1 dB, respectively. Power consumption is 95 mW/channel from a 5 V supply, or 380 mW for all four channels. Power is distributed 35% for the PrA, and 65% for the remainder of the circuit. The preamps can be shut down via the SP12 and SP34 pins if a user wants to use the VGAs only. However, to avoid feedthrough around the preamp, feedback resistors should not be installed. ENABLE SUMMARY Table 5 summarizes the enable/shutdown logic and resulting supply current. Table 5.
